dc.description.abstract The Objective of this project is to provide Natural Life with a business solution that will provide clear insight into its business processes and an overall increase in the efficiency of the business as a whole, providing Natural Life with a profit increasing solution and giving them the ability of problem solving many situations that might occur within their business. The total Business Process Re-Engineering will focus on increasing visibility of the internal processes and improve process performance, thus dealing with the retailer part of the supply chain and all the processes and attributes affecting it. By analysing the available data, problem areas were detected and solutions could be developed for those areas. By increasing operational efficiency and maintaining more optimal stock levels Natural life can increase their useable capital by up to R125 000 as well as increasing their profits without increasing turnover. A generally smoother and more efficient business process can be easily maintained by implementing the simple suggested solutions. en_US
